I. Introduction

The parties have filed cross-appeals of the district court's order awarding $371,362 in attorney's fees and $70,828.84 in costs in a case where the sole relief obtained was a judgment in the amount of one dollar. We have jurisdiction pursuant to 28 U.S.C. § 1291, and we reverse.
